English: WIPO Director General Daren Tang speaks at a meeting with Chinese Premier Li Keqiang at Diaoyutai State Guest House on February 5, 2022.
During the meeting, Mr. Tang expressed his appreciation for the invitation to the Winter Olympics and China's ongoing support to multilateralism and commitment to innovation. They also discussed further cooperation between WIPO and China, along with the importance of intellectual property in driving economic and social development. During his visit to China, Mr. Tang also received China's instrument of accession to two key WIPO treaties – China Joins Two Key WIPO Treaties. Copyright: WIPO. Photo: Hongbing CHEN.
